Fares
Local bus fare is $2 - (Senior-Disabled fare is $1.00).
Express bus fare is $5 - (Senior-Disabled fare is $2.50).
MetroCard®
Pay-Per-Ride and 7-Day Express Bus Plus MetroCard
are accepted on all MTA buses (local, Limited-Stop and express)
and on the subway.
Unlimited Ride MetroCard (7-Day and
30-Day) are accepted on all but express buses.
All buses accept
exact fare in coins, but not pennies or half dollars
Request-A-Stop
Provided the bus operator considers it safe,
passengers may be let off along the route at other than an official
bus stop only between 10 PM - 5 AM within the New York City.

Fares
MetroCard® is accepted on all MTA New York City Transit
trains and on local buses
. Express buses only accept 7-Day
Express Bus Plus MetroCard or Pay-Per-Ride MetroCard. Buses accept exact fare in coins, but not pennies or half dollars.
Free Transfers
Unlimited-Ride MetroCard permits free transfers
to all but express buses (between subway and local bus, local
bus and local bus, etc.)
Pay-Per-Ride MetroCard allows one free
transfer of equal or lesser value if you complete your transfer
within two hours of the time you pay your full fare with the same
MetroCard. If you pay your local bus fare with coins, ask for a
free magnetic-strip transfer to use on another local bus.
Reduced-Fare Benefits
You are eligible for reduced-fare
benefits if you are at least 65 years of age or have a qualifying
disability. Benefits are available (except on peak-hour express
buses) with proper identification, including Reduced-Fare
MetroCard or Medicare card (Medicaid cards do not qualify).

Cheapest by far is by subway/Metro North rail. Take AirTrain ($5) from terminal to Jamaica Station, transfer to E subway ($2.25) to Lexington Ave/53rd St, transfer to downtown #6 subway for one stop to 42nd St/Grand Central, at Grand Central take the Metro North-Harlem Line train to White Plains ($7.75 off-peak, $10.50 peak) and then take the #12 Bee Line local bus from the Transit Center to Lincoln Ave/SUNY Purchase.
